Analysis

Kyrgyzstan recorded 661 hectares for annual area burnt by wildfires in 2026. That is the lowest value across all 15 years on record.

That represents a change of down 90.5% on the previous year and down 93.4% over ten years.

Over the whole period, annual area burnt by wildfires in Kyrgyzstan peaked at 19,067 hectares in 2012 and was at its lowest, 661 hectares, in 2026.

That places Kyrgyzstan 145th out of 248 countries with data for 2026, putting it in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
